P886 KWL is a 1996 Toyota Rav 4 in Turquoise with a 1,998cc petrol engine. This vehicle has been through 21 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 81%.
Across all 1996 Toyota Rav 4 models, the average MOT pass rate is 69.6% with a typical mileage of 111,260 miles. This particular vehicle has performed better than the average for its year.
The most common reason a Toyota Rav 4 fails its MOT is tyre tread depth below requirements of 1.6mm, accounting for 115 recorded failures. If you're considering buying P886 KWL,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.
The Toyota Rav 4 typically stays on UK roads for around 32 years. At 30 years old, this Toyota Rav 4 is approaching the upper end of the typical lifespan for this model.
